Frequently asked questions about windows services

When you are putting your house on the market, you may want to make some improvements to increase the value of your home. Some improvements, such as replacing insulation will likely add value to the house you’re selling. Other improvements, like replacing the windows before selling your home may not make as much sense. Installing replacement windows is an expensive proposition, and you may not recoup that expense when you sell the house. However, you may be able to make some smaller window improvements that would increase your home’s energy efficiency. Potential buyers are often impressed by a home’s energy efficiency. A more energy efficient home whether it is thanks to replacement windows or due to a well-maintained HVAC system saves potential buyers money over time.

When you are getting your house reading to sell, you can upgrade your windows in one simple way. Check the perimeters of your windows. If there are places where the caulking is cracked or missing. Apply fresh caulk where necessary. If you’re selling an older home, or if you have lots of windows, you may want to hire a contractor to help out with repairing your windows to save time for other chores.

If your car has four-wheel drive, you know that you have to replace all the tires at once. This is not true for your home. If you have a limited budget, it is fine to replace a single window. You can wait until your window budget increases to replace the rest as they start to show signs of wear and tear. However, there are many advantages to replacing all your windows at once if you have the budgetary flexibility.

Replacing your windows with newer, more efficient models, you can increase your home’s energy efficiency which will save you money. Also, a whole-house window replacement presents an opportunity to spruce up the aesthetics of your home. You can increase curb appeal, and make the rooms look more sophisticated or homy depending on your stylistic preferences. If you are deciding whether to replace a single window, or replace all the windows at once, it may make sense to consult a design or interior decorator. They’ll know the ins and outs of window selection and installation.

There are many factors to consider when choosing windows for your home. You’ll want to choose a window style. For example, if you are creating a focal point with the new windows, considering bay, bow, specialty or special shaped windows may make sense. You’ll want to pick a frame material such as wood, fiberglass, aluminum or vinyl. Each window frame material has advantages and disadvantages. Next, you’ll need to decide on the best glass package for your windows. There is single, double, and triple pane glass. When choosing the glass pack you’ll want to weigh the initial cost against the long term payoffs.

When choosing windows for your home, it may make sense to work with an established window replacement and repair company. A window expert can help you sort through the many choices you’ll need to make in order to come up with the best windows for your home. They can offer a detailed, written estimate for the cost of an installation. Hiring a window pro can offer peace of mind and save you time and headaches down the line.

Homeowners have a few crucial responsibilities when they are having professionals replace a home’s windows. First, if the home was built before 1978, the contractor must be trained in working with lead-based paint. Next, talk with the window replacement pro before the day of the job. Find out how much space they’ll need to safely carry out the project. Be sure to clear space around the windows for the workers. Establish how the window contractors will enter and leave your house, and where they can park. Remove window treatments. Make sure kids and pets are well out of the way the day the home improvement project takes place. This is for everyone’s safety. Discuss how the old windows will be disposed of, and how the contractors plan to clean up after the job is done.

When the contractors arrive with the new windows, check the labels. If you have ordered energy efficient windows make sure the correct ones have been delivered. Check for any hairline fractures, breaks, or chips in the replacement windows. If you are an active partner with the contractors before and during your home’s window replacement project, it is sure to be a success.

The question about whether replacement windows should be installed from the inside or outside is tricky. The answer depends on a number of factors. One thing to keep in mind is that some companies may prefer to install replacement windows from the outside and use this as a selling point. It may make sense to ask your window installation pro why they are choosing to install the windows from the inside or the outside. Sometimes, due to the type of windows and interior trim there is no other choice but to install the windows from the outside of the home. It may be less disruptive to install replacement windows from the exterior.
